I'm Gretchen Baer, artist, activist, and creator of the Hillary Clinton "Hillcar" art car. I live in Bisbee Arizona, an arts community 6 miles from the U.S./Mexico Border wall, on which my group,The Border Bedazzlers are painting the world's longest kids mural. I am a Hillary Clinton Super Volunteer and I support my candidate with my Hillary-themed art car. The Hillcar is a 1989 Toyota Corolla, painted with images of Hillary Clinton, decorated with jewels, toys, game pieces, and lots of glitter. The Hillcar has campaigned for Hillary in 15 states since 2008.
We recently campaigned with the Hillcar on the East Coast in 6 states during their Democratic primaries. We got out the vote in a burst of color, smiles and fun in New York, Conneticut, Rhode Island, Delaware, Maryland and Pennsylvania. We also talked about the need for more art in schools, more free art programs for kids, as well as advocating for good border relations through art.
